The rol-6 co-injection marker causes an expressional artifact in CP09.

GFP expression in the male tail of transgenic worms injected with an empty GFP vector (pPD95.75) along with rol-6(su1006) plasmid (pRF4) (A) or ttx-3p::GFP plasmid (B). Exclusive CP09 expression was observed in seven out of 12 independent transgenic lines injected with GFP vector + pRF4 (7/12), whereas no CP09 expression was observed in 10 independent lines with GFP vector + ttx-3p::GFP (0/10). Asterisks indicate autofluorescence in the spicule. Scale bar, 20 μm.
